I seem to be coming to this thread a little late but the folk who are entertaining conspiricy theories and those who think they are being 'got at' may I suggest that you log on to this web site and quiz yourself www.organisedwisdom.com/Quiz/Paranoid_Personality_Test (I mean no insult to genuinely poorly people). It seems to me that many people came out to Spain in the 'good times' when the £ was 1.4 0 Eur or more, they had sold property (especially in the south) in the UK and got a mega amount then bought cheap property in Spain life was good and inexpensive. Then the bad times hit and many had never considered that the good times would end and made no provision. Add to this the illegal property problems, the Spanish madness of red tape and corruptness and it is understandable that many are unhappy and want to, or have gone back to the UK. But please remember that some of us are happy to be in Spain enjoy mixing with the local Spanish and are adapting to a new and exciting life. Of course there are problems and issues but life is what you make it - most of us will be dust in 50 years (actually 30 would do me!) :mrgreen:
